Convey samples/paperwork: In the event you’re coming in for the schedule checkup, deliver fecal and urine samples. We all know—gross! Nevertheless the vet will Nearly absolutely request this, and bringing them with you stops the need for the annoying retrieval or An additional drop-off check out.

Inquire about photographs which might be considered elective but could possibly be proposed in your area. By way of example, some Animals get a rattlesnake vaccine to shield against real looking regional threats.
